Cuprins

I. Cosmic Gamma Rays, X-Rays, and Neutrinos.- The Sky as Viewed from the Compton Gamma-Ray Observatory.- Cosmic Gamma-Ray Bursts.- Gamma-Ray Production in the Winds of Wolf-Rayet Stars.- Origin of High-Energy X-Ray Emission from NGC 253.- Spectral and Temporal Variability in Low-Mass X-Raybinaries.- Solar and Supernova Neutrinos.- Neutrino Masses in Astrophysics.- II. Cosmic Rays.- Source Composition of Cosmic Rays and Models of Origin.- Highlights of the 1993 ICRC on Composition and Propagation of Cosmic Rays; and on Neutrinos.- Recent Results from the Fly’s Eye Experiment.- The High Resolution (Hires) Fly’s Eye Detector.- The Hegra Experiment at La Palma.- The Extensive Air Shower Experiment in Tibet.- Production and Acceleration of Ultra High Energy Particles by Black Holes and Strings.- Cosmic Ray Nonlinear Effects in Space Plasma: 1. General Characteristics and Dynamic Galactic Halo.- 2. Dynamic Heliosphere.- III. Pulsars and Supernova Remnants.- Pulsars: Recent Results on Their Physics and Their Dynamics.- Synchrotron and Inverse Compton Radiation in Supernova Remnants.- IV. Cosmology.- The Big Bang and the Infrared Sky as Seen by Cobe.- Inflation, The Top and All that.- Formation of Galaxies in a Dark Matter Dominated Universe: A New Approach.- New Ways in Cosmology: I. Friedmann-Lemaitre Model Derived from the Lyman Alpha Forest in Quasar Spectra.- II. Alternative Models for the Very Early Universe.- Participants.- Author Index.
